Historical and Social Factors Influencing Perception of Body Size
The perception of body size in Samoan culture is intertwined with historical and social factors. Historically, larger body size was often associated with strength, prosperity, and social standing. This perception, while potentially influenced by cultural values and dietary habits, has been subject to change alongside evolving social norms. It is crucial to acknowledge the dynamic nature of these perceptions and understand how they have evolved over time.

Impact of Diverse Food Access and Modern Diets
Access to a wider variety of foods, including processed and fast foods, has increased in Samoan communities. This shift in dietary habits, alongside a decline in traditional food preparation, can lead to imbalances in nutrient intake. Increased consumption of sugary drinks and processed foods can contribute to weight gain and other health issues.
